Clam Chowder

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4-6 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

A comforting and creamy New England Clam Chowder recipe that is perfect for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cans (6.5 ounces each) chopped clams, drained and juice reserved
  • 4 slices bacon, chopped
  • 1 medium onion, diced
  • 2 stalks celery, diced
  • 2 medium potatoes, peeled and diced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 2 cups clam juice (or reserved juice plus water)
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Chopped f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, cook the chopped bacon over medium heat until crispy. Remove the bacon and set aside, leaving the drippings in the pot.
  2. Add the diced onion and celery to the pot and sauté in the bacon drippings until softened, about 5 minutes.
  3. Stir in the diced potatoes, clam juice, and thyme.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until the potatoes are tender, about 15 minutes.
  4. Add the heavy cream and the drained clams to the pot. Stir to combine and heat through for another 5 minutes.
  5.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Serve hot, garnished with the reserved bacon and chopped parsley.

Notes

  • For a thicker chowder, mash some of the potatoes before adding the cream.
  • Substitute the bacon with diced smoked sausage for a different flavor profile.
